Simple Table Query on Azure PRO

The Azure platform allows us to store data through several “no sql” services. One of them is tables. Each table holds entities. Unlike tables on relational databases, these tables don’t follow a schema. Each entity they hold can be with a different number of properties (similarly to MongoDB).
